Output 3eb9f251d96e15d8178520687040482cb357b91efdaca81b4a49997878b687f3:0

value
2503540
script pubkey
OP_0 OP_PUSHBYTES_20 6a5b6092e9e24898ccabf88a18f2c18859a638a6
address
bc1qdfdkpyhfufyf3n9tlz9p3ukp3pv6vw9xlnd9tc
transaction
3eb9f251d96e15d8178520687040482cb357b91efdaca81b4a49997878b687f3
confirmations
148894
spent
true